SEO教程

SEO教程

Products

当前位置:首页 > SEO教程 >

Docker网络类型,你了解多少?🤔

96SEO 2025-11-09 20:43 0


Bridge 网络是 Docker 默认创建的网络类型。它Neng让容器之间通过容器名或 IP 地址进行传信。这种网络适用于单机上运行的容器之间的传信。

Docker 网络的类型有哪些

Host 网络会将容器直接连接到主机的网络栈上,容器用主机的 IP 和端口。这种网络适用于对网络性Neng要求hen高大的应用程序,比方说需要直接访问主机网络材料的情况。

Macvlan 网络Neng让容器直接获取物理网络接口的 MAC 地址,从而表现得就像物理网络上的一个真实实设备。这种网络适用于需要与物理网络设备进行直接传信的应用程序

None 网络会将容器与随便哪个网络dou隔离,容器内部只Neng用 loopback 网络接口。这种网络适用于不需要网络连接的应用程序,或者需要自定义网络配置的情况。

Overlay 网络Neng跨优良几个 Docker 主机创建网络,让容器在不同主机上也Neng互相传信。这种网络适用于微服务架构和集群部署的应用程序

一、 Bridge网络

Bridge网络是Docker默认创建的网络类型,它允许容器之间通过容器名或IP地址进行传信。在Bridge网络中,个个容器dou会分配一个独立的IP地址,并且容器之间Neng通过这些个IP地址进行传信。

Bridge网络的特点如下:

  • 容器之间Neng通过容器名或IP地址进行传信。
  • 个个容器dou会分配一个独立的IP地址。
  • 容器之间的传信是通过虚拟网络接口进行的。

二、 Host网络

Host网络将容器直接连接到主机的网络栈上,容器用主机的IP和端口。在Host网络中,容器与主机共享相同的网络命名地方,所以呢容器Neng直接访问主机的网络材料。

Host网络的特点如下:

  • 容器与主机共享相同的网络命名地方。
  • 容器Neng直接访问主机的网络材料。
  • 容器之间无法通过容器名或IP地址进行传信。

三、 Macvlan网络

Macvlan网络允许容器直接获取物理网络接口的MAC地址,从而表现得就像物理网络上的一个真实实设备。在Macvlan网络中, 个个容器douNeng拥有自己的MAC地址和IP地址,并且Neng像物理设备一样与其他网络设备进行传信。

Macvlan网络的特点如下:

  • 容器Neng拥有自己的MAC地址和IP地址。
  • 容器Neng像物理设备一样与其他网络设备进行传信。
  • 适用于需要与物理网络设备进行直接传信的应用程序

四、 None网络

None网络将容器与随便哪个网络dou隔离,容器内部只Neng用loopback网络接口。在None网络中,容器无法与外部网络进行传信,但Neng与容器内部的进程进行传信。

None网络的特点如下:

  • 容器无法与外部网络进行传信。
  • 容器内部只Neng用loopback网络接口。
  • 适用于不需要网络连接的应用程序或需要自定义网络配置的情况。

五、 Overlay网络

Overlay网络Neng跨优良几个Docker主机创建网络,让容器在不同主机上也Neng互相传信。在Overlay网络中,个个容器dou会分配一个独一个的IP地址,并且Neng通过这些个IP地址进行传信。

Overlay网络的特点如下:

  • Neng跨优良几个Docker主机创建网络。
  • 容器在不同主机上也Neng互相传信。
  • 适用于微服务架构和集群部署的应用程序

Docker给了许多种网络类型,以满足不同场景下的需求。通过了解这些个网络类型的特点和适用场景, 我们Nenggeng优良地用Docker网络,搞优良应用程序的可用性和性Neng。


标签: 类型

提交需求或反馈

Demand feedback